What is the effect of the metaphor in the poem "Can't" by Edgar Guest?
GuDViN [60]

<u>Answer:</u>

<em>The effect of the metaphor in the poem "Can't" by Edgar Guest is that</em><u><em> it helps the reader understand the relationship between self-doubt and failure. </em></u>

<em>The correct answer is</em><u><em> option D. </em></u>

<u>Explanation:</u>

Guest newly defines the word “can’t.” He calls it the father of feeble endeavour. He also addresses it as a parent of terror and half-hearted work. Can’t is the word that starts with self-doubt which leads to failure. Can’t means to give up. This is what the metaphor is trying to explain to the readers. It clearly aids us to understand the failure and the self-doubt present within ours.
